Understanding‌ the‍ Scope‍ of‍ Post-Fracture Rehabilitation

Defining Physiotherapy’s Role‍

Physiotherapy, often‌ a‌ crucial‍ component of‍ post-fracture‌ recovery, is a healthcare‍ profession focused on‌ restoring function and‍ well-being‍ through exercise‌ and‌ movement. It extends beyond simply‌ addressing pain; it proactively‍ promotes‌ a full recovery‌ by‍ restoring‍ mobility, enhancing strength, and improving‍ overall quality‌ of life. A qualified physiotherapist‍ will develop‌ a personalized plan‍ considering the specific bone‌ fracture, its‍ location, and‌ the individual’s unique needs‍ and goals. In the‌ context of bone fracture recovery, physiotherapy plays‌ a‍ pivotal‍ role‍ in‍ guiding patients through‌ each‌ phase of the healing process.

Identifying‍ Pain Management Strategies

Pain‍ management‌ is a‍ critical aspect of‌ post-fracture recovery. Physiotherapy‍ professionals often employ various‍ techniques, including‍ manual therapy, targeted exercises, and‌ modalities such‍ as heat‍ or cold‌ therapy, to minimize discomfort‌ and promote‍ healing. Individual responses‌ to‍ pain‍ differ, emphasizing the importance‍ of personalized‌ treatment‍ plans to‌ effectively address‌ pain levels‌ and‌ promote‌ optimal‍ healing. This personalized‌ approach is‍ especially‌ crucial‌ in addressing potential complications‌ that could arise‌ from the trauma, such‌ as muscle‍ atrophy‌ or joint stiffness.

Restoring Mobility and Range of Motion

Early‍ Interventions for Enhanced Healing‍

Early intervention plays a‍ pivotal role in‍ optimizing‌ fracture recovery. Physiotherapy‌ typically involves gentle, gradual movements to‍ restore the full range of‍ motion, helping to‍ prevent stiffness and maintain joint flexibility. This is‍ often‍ achieved through‌ targeted‍ exercises‍ designed for regaining mobility in‍ the affected limb while supporting‍ the‌ integrity of the healing‌ bone.

Targeted Exercises and‌ Mobility‍ Improvement

Physiotherapists‍ tailor exercises to the specific‍ needs‌ of‍ each‍ patient, aiming to enhance flexibility and‍ mobility. The goal‌ is to‍ gradually‍ increase the range of‌ motion and improve‍ the joint’s‌ function as‌ the‍ fracture‌ heals, enabling individuals‌ to‍ resume‍ their normal‍ activities more‌ quickly. Early‍ mobilization‌ also‍ reduces the‌ risk of muscle atrophy‍ and contractures, common‌ complications in cases of prolonged immobility. Specific exercises might include passive‍ range‌ of‍ motion, active range‍ of motion, and resistance exercises, focusing on‍ the‍ affected‍ limb.

Enhancing‍ Strength‌ and‌ Functional‍ Recovery

Gradual Progression‍ to‍ Restore Strength

Physiotherapists‍ progressively‍ introduce‍ strength-building exercises as‍ the fracture heals. These exercises‍ focus‍ on building‍ strength‌ in the‌ muscles‌ surrounding‍ the affected area, ensuring‍ balanced‌ strength and‍ preventing potential compensatory movements that could‍ impede‍ recovery. This‍ gradual approach is‍ essential in preventing‍ injuries‌ and promoting safe and effective‍ healing.

Functional‌ Training for Daily Activities

Building strength isn’t‍ merely about‍ isolating‌ muscles but also about‌ improving‌ daily‌ functions. Physiotherapists‍ incorporate functional‍ training into their programs, assisting patients in performing everyday‍ tasks safely‌ and‌ effectively. Examples‌ include‌ exercises mimicking‌ activities‍ of‍ daily‌ living, such as getting‌ out of bed, climbing‍ stairs, or carrying‍ groceries. The goal‌ is to‍ ensure patients‍ can‌ return‍ to their normal daily activities‌ without‌ compromising‌ the integrity‍ of the healing‌ bone.

Utilizing‌ Technology and‍ Advancements in Post-Fracture Physiotherapy

Integration of‌ Technology in Treatment Plans

Modern‌ physiotherapy utilizes a‍ range‍ of technologies‌ to‌ provide‍ more accurate‌ and‍ efficient‌ treatment plans. For example, gait analysis can help identify‍ gait abnormalities‍ that‌ might‌ arise‌ as‍ a‌ result‍ of a‌ fracture. This‍ data-driven‍ approach can‍ assist in‌ creating‌ personalized‌ plans for gait rehabilitation that‌ addresses the‌ specific‍ needs of each patient. This technology-driven‌ approach, while‍ increasingly‌ prevalent, remains‌ essential in‍ monitoring‍ and optimizing recovery.

Optimizing‍ Outcomes with‍ Advanced‍ Techniques‌

Advanced physiotherapy techniques, such‌ as‍ ultrasound-guided interventions, may be‌ employed to‌ expedite tissue healing‍ and‌ reduce inflammation. This‌ advanced approach, though not always‌ necessary, can‌ significantly‍ contribute‌ to the overall recovery‌ process‍ and‍ should be‍ discussed‌ with a qualified physiotherapist. The optimal approach to care‌ depends on‍ the‍ specific fracture‍ and‌ the individual patient’s needs‌ and preferences.

Addressing‌ Potential‍ Complications‍ in‌ Post-Fracture Recovery

Recognizing‌ and Preventing‌ Potential‍ Issues‌

Unfortunately, certain‍ complications‍ might‍ arise during‍ the‍ post-fracture recovery‍ phase. These‍ complications, though‌ less common, include‌ muscle‌ atrophy, reduced‌ bone density, or‌ delayed‌ healing. It is‍ crucial‌ to‌ recognize‌ these potential issues‌ and‍ address‌ them promptly. Early‍ physiotherapy‌ intervention‍ often plays‌ a key role‌ in preventing‍ and managing‌ these‌ complications.

Adapting Treatment‌ for‌ Unique Patient Needs‍

Each‌ patient’s‍ recovery journey is unique and‌ requires a‌ customized treatment‍ plan. Physiotherapists adapt‍ their approaches based‌ on factors‍ such‌ as‌ the‍ individual’s‍ age, overall health, and‍ the specific type of‌ fracture. This‍ flexible‌ approach‌ ensures the highest possible success‍ rate‍ for each patient and‌ empowers‍ them‌ to‍ take‌ an active role‍ in their‌ recovery process.
